If i have a vector, lets say L=[10;10;10;11;11;13;13] which is associated to another vector X=[1;6;65;34;21;73;14] and I want to create a third vector, Z, with almost all the elements in X, but just replacing a 0 in X when the element (i,j) from L changes. Lets say that the result that I want should look like this Z=[1;6;65;0;21;0;14]
Any ideas how to solve this?
